First Contentful Paint First Contentful Paint — how long until the browser renders the first piece of content. Under 1.8s is good.

Largest Contentful Paint Largest Contentful Paint — how long until the largest visible element loads. Under 2.5s is good.

Total Blocking Time Total Blocking Time — total time the main thread was blocked, preventing user input. Under 200ms is good.

Cumulative Layout Shift Cumulative Layout Shift — measures visual stability. How much the page layout shifts during loading. Under 0.1 is good.

Speed Index Speed Index — how quickly content is visually displayed during load. Under 3.4s is good.

Time to Interactive Time to Interactive — how long until the page is fully interactive and responds to user input. Under 3.8s is good.

Third-party scripts (analytics, ads, social, A/B testing) often dominate execution time — every one is a perf-and-privacy tax.
Learn more ▾ ▴
Each third-party script is a black box: you don't control when it loads, what it executes, or how much it grows. They often account for a major share of total blocking time on average sites (HTTP Archive's Web Almanac documents the trend). Audit which ones you actually need, defer the rest, and use facade patterns (lite-youtube, lite-vimeo) for embedded media.
